Mary Kathleen Rose, BA, RMT, is a pioneer in the field of touch therapies for the elderly and the chronically ill. She developed Comfort Touch®, a nurturing style of acupressure, in response to the special needs of people in medical settings, hospice, and home care.
She is the author of the textbook Comfort Touch® Massage for the Elderly and the Ill (LWW, 2009) and DVD of the same title, as well as numerous magazine articles.
In all of her work, Mary seeks to embody the qualities of the Wise Woman Tradition, including – groundedness, nurturance, and respect. As an artist she has a passionate interest in the relationship between creativity and healing. She loves music, dance, canoeing, and gardening.
